Guest guest Posted August 29, 2003 Report Share Posted August 29, 2003 Baconless Bits Source: www.veganchef.com 2/3 cup water 1/3 cup tamari or Bragg Liquid Aminos 1 T. olive oil 1 T. maple syrup 1/2 t. garlic powder 1 1/4 cups TVP (textured vegetable protein flakes) In a small saucepan, place all of the ingredients, except the TVP, and bring to a boil. Remove the saucepan from the heat, add the TVP, stir well to combine, and set aside for 10 minutes to rehydrate the TVP. Lightly oil (or spray with oil) a non-stick cookie sheet. Place the TVP mixture on the cookie sheet and spread to form an even thin layer. Bake at 350 degrees for 8 minutes, stir, spread to an even layer, and bake an additional 8-10 minutes or until TVP is lightly browned and dry. Remove from the oven and allow to cool. Store in an airtight container in the refrigerator. Use in place of commercially made " bacon bits " on salads, baked potatoes, vegetables, or in your favorite recipes.
